  • But what doesn't make sense is the way you're using the word scales, any and every song is in a scale, whether you purposely wanted to play in the scale or not, a scale is just a set of w/e notes you want in a song, and notes are consistant points in the spectrum that is sound, music. When you say scales are easy to play it also doesn't make sense, major and minor scales of course are easy, that's what most songs have, but use of intricate scales and key changes in songs are much more difficult.

  • alright short and sweet now:

    4/4

    bottom 4=what type of note will be used to measure the time. (4 is a quarter note, 8 is an 8th note, 16 is a 16th note)

    top 4=how many of that bottom note are in the measure.

    so 4/4=four quarter notes per measure...I can't fit in my in-depth explanation, sorry.
